GLSEN Honors ABC's Modern Family

By Brian Scott Lipton • Oct 9, 2010 • Los Angeles
GLSEN, the Gay, Lesbian and Straight Education Network, honored the Emmy Award-winning ABC comedy Modern Family at the Respect Awards in Los Angeles on Friday, October 8. The event was hosted by Rob Reiner.

The series, which recently began its second season, focuses on a diverse suburban family, including a gay couple with an adopted Asian daughter. It won the 2010 Emmy Award for Best Comedy Series.

The show's stars include theater veterans Ty Burrell, Jesse Tyler Ferguson, Sarah Hyland, and Sofia Vergara, along with Ed O'Neill, Julie Bowen, and Eric Stonestreet.

Celebrities who attended the event include Florence Henderson, Ginnifer Goodwin, Chloe Sevigny, Jeanne Tripplehorn, and Corky Ballas.
